Deutsche Post DHL Group and Russian Post expand cooperation for international parcel shipments

Both CEOs, Frank Appel and Dmitry Strashnov, came to this agreement today in Bonn. In doing so, both companies are responding to the rising parcel volumes resulting from the boom in international e-commerce. Deutsche Post DHL hands over Russia-bound parcels to Russian Post in BerlinRussian Post benefits from growing utilization of its parcel networkBetter quality and more reliable delivery times for parcel shipments to RussiaDeutsche Post DHL Group, the world’s leading provider of logistics services, and Russian Post, the state-owned postal service of the Russian Federation, are expanding their cooperation in the area of international parcel shipments between Germany and Russia. Just in the ‘Nick’ of time, Santa arrives at PIER 39 to collect children’s letters

A special area will be set up where children can write letters to Santa. Postal employees will be on hand to assist children by helping them decorate their special letters before mailing. The Postal Service began receiving letters addressed to Santa Claus more than 100 years ago. It wasn’t until 1912 that Postmaster General Frank Hitchcock authorized local Postmasters to allow individuals and institutions to use letters addressed to Santa Claus for philanthropic purposes.
